What Is The Symbol Of Bauxite. Aluminum, symbolized as al on the periodic table, is a chemical element with atomic number 13. An oxide of aluminum, occurring in nature as various minerals such as bauxite, corundum, etc. So bauxite is group of hydrated aluminum oxides, al(oh)3 with possible additional al and (oh) so it can be written as al2o3.nh2o.
